揭秘县城家门口滑雪场的“点金术”
Xin Lang Cai Jing· 2026-02-01 21:21
Core Insights - The newly opened Xuyi First Mountain Ski Resort is positioned as a convenient local ski destination, attracting both local residents and visitors from nearby cities, which enhances its revenue potential [1][2] - The ski resort employs a unique operational model that allows it to remain open year-round by transforming its facilities for different seasonal activities, thus mitigating the traditional winter-only revenue model of ski resorts [2][3] - The resort aims to stimulate regional consumption by creating a comprehensive experience that includes skiing, dining, and accommodation, thereby enhancing the overall economic vitality of the area [3] Group 1 - The Xuyi First Mountain Ski Resort is located just a few minutes from the county center, making it easily accessible for local residents and tourists [1] - The resort features modern facilities and a variety of rental equipment, which has led to positive visitor experiences and increased foot traffic [1] - Local residents and visitors from nearby cities form a steady customer base, reducing marketing costs and ensuring consistent revenue [1] Group 2 - The resort's operational strategy includes a "one area, two uses, four seasons open" model, allowing it to switch from skiing in winter to grass skiing and water slides in other seasons [2] - This multifunctional approach significantly reduces asset idle time and increases revenue potential throughout the year, leading to improved asset turnover and efficiency [2] - By diversifying income sources beyond just ski ticket sales, the resort can maintain a stable revenue stream across all seasons [2] Group 3 - The ski resort collaborates with nearby historical districts and hospitality services to create a "micro-vacation" experience, encouraging visitors to spend more time and money in the area [3] - This interconnected model helps to unlock the economic potential of local resources, contributing to the overall growth of the cultural and tourism sector in Xuyi [3]
